Nathan Ridge
Nathan Ridge
> Similar thing has been already [implemented](https://github.com/clangd/vscode-clangd/pull/193), but it seems a bit crude in my opinion. I think it should be handled like a drop-down menu with options rather than...
> > If this is possible to do, PRs to change it are very welcome, and I'm happy to review them. > > I'd happily look into that, but I'm...
> > While I haven't been involved in vscode-clangd from the beginning, my understanding is that the project has made a deliberate choice not to try to use the same...
> > Maybe I misunderstood the suggestion; I thought you meant having a dropdown where e.g. some (but not all) options include a color picker contained within them. > >...
Thanks. To summarize, the proposal is for two changes: 1. Change the kind of the setting used to switch between the "background color" style and the "opacity" style, from a...
> I'll update the title of this issue to track the first one, and file a follow-up issue to track the second one. #654 is the second issue
This type of bug tends to be related to clangd's [preamble optimization](https://github.com/clangd/clangd/issues/200#issuecomment-554973739). A quick check shows that the first diagnostic is coming from the preamble (which I think is expected),...
The second part of the bug (the location of the "note" being changed to be the same as the location of the main diagnostic) I suspect is a consequence of...
> I don't want to disable header insertion via my editor (as a cli flag) because on non-module projects (i.e: most of the time) I do want it enabled. Does...
> I disabled it in user settings and still got insertions. Note that the [`HeaderInsertion`](https://clangd.llvm.org/config.html#headerinsertion) config setting is new in clangd 21. In older versions, you need to use the...